Transaction 95d35e79d5d94897f7523dc83b35e3d4b82cf10b39ba2ad81f620521fb926f65

1 Input
2 Outputs
  • 95d35e79d5d94897f7523dc83b35e3d4b82cf10b39ba2ad81f620521fb926f65:0
  • value  6608745
    address  366H1d4GMNAWRKTZsLP86EW1VsdqDiHiXR
  • 95d35e79d5d94897f7523dc83b35e3d4b82cf10b39ba2ad81f620521fb926f65:1
  • value  129603850
    address  3Q7UpouaQCjoreL3t36aDnUUHDPKiPmcTD